Broken Seals

The window seals prevent the outside air from entering and argon, which is used to keep your home warm from escaping. Over time, the seal can become brittle, or even break. It is important to watch for signs of a broken seal and then call experts to ensure your energy efficiency is at its peak.

Fog between double- and triple-paned windows is the most obvious indicator of a damaged window seal. This is caused by a flaw in the edge seals that hold each pane of glass inside the IGU (insulated-glazing unit).

When humid air enters your windows, it produces condensation and the fog can be seen. While this may be an issue that is not too significant, it means that your IGU does not provide its full insulating value. Additionally any inert gas that was contained within the u p v c window repairs is now flowing out, thereby reducing the window's energy-saving capabilities.

A skilled window technician will inspect the IGU and reseal any edges that are damaged. This is an inexpensive and quick solution to the issue, however it's important to note that this is only an interim solution. If you wish to stop the fog from recurring then you'll need to have your window repair man sealed regularly.

Condensation between the Panes

Modern double-glazed windows are prone to condensation on the glass. It usually occurs by double glazing windows that isn't able to create a secure seal and the interior air temperature is higher than the outside air. This could cause the moisture between the glass panes to build up, giving them an appearance of a milky or fogging. This can be extremely annoying and there are some quick solutions. But the best solution is to employ an expert who will drill holes into the glass's outer layer and clean the windows within and then install one way air vents.

The majority of homeowners will experience condensation on the inside of their double glazed windows from time to time particularly after renovations such as plastering or Repair double glazed window painting where there is a significant humidity level and the surface can easily turn damp. It is not common to find condensation on windows. This is usually an indication of problems with the insulation unit.

A broken seal can cause the problem It's also a sign that the spacer bar between the two panes might not be working correctly. The spacer bar is filled with desiccant. This material is highly absorbent, and it draws any moisture that is trapped in the "air gap" between the window panes. This could become saturated in the event that the window seal is imperfect. Once it is full of desiccant, condensation can form on the inside.

The moisture that is allowed to remain on windows and other surfaces can cause mould and rot growth that are not just ugly but also harmful to your health. If condensation is left on your windows for a prolonged time, it can eventually lead to leaks and loose windows.

The good news is that there are a few easy ways to tackle the condensation in the double glazed windows. The windows should be opened for a few minutes each day to let air flow in will help to reduce humidity levels and avoid condensation, as will using a dehumidifier. These electrical appliances are available for purchase at an affordable cost and are typically used in kitchens and bathrooms to eliminate excess moisture.

Draughts

Draughts could indicate that your double glazing system is not working properly. These draughts can be irritating especially in winter. They could also cause your home to lose more heat than it should. You can check if your uPVC windows have a good seal by looking for a gap within the frame or noticing the presence of a draft.

If you feel a draught emanating from your window, then the rubber seals may have failed. The seals are designed to compress when the window repairs near me is closed, and stop cold air from getting into your home. If they're not doing this and are not doing this, then it's time to have them replaced.

Broken handles on windows or doors can cause draughts. The handles won't close properly, causing gaps where draughts enter. If this is the case, then it is a good idea to contact an expert company that specializes in double glazed window repairs since they will be capable of fixing these parts for you.

Double-glazed windows can be difficult to open or close after a certain period of time. The frame may expand or shrink due to temperature fluctuations. You can try wiping down the frames with cold water, but it is best to repair them by a professional.
